Hoisin Beef Noodles


  • Author: Marina Savoy
  • Total Time: 25–30 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 4
  • Diet: Low Lactose

Description

This quick and easy stir-fry features tender beef, crisp vegetables, and noodles tossed in a savory-sweet hoisin sauce. Perfect for busy weeknights and customizable with your favorite add-ins.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 500g beef (sirloin or flank), thinly sliced

  • 400g rice or egg noodles

  • 4 tbsp hoisin sauce

  • 2 tbsp soy sauce (or tamari)

  • 1 tbsp oyster sauce

  • 3 cloves garlic, minced

  • 1 tbsp fresh ginger, grated

  • 1 red bell pepper, sliced

  • 1 large carrot, julienned

  • 23 green onions, chopped

  • 1 tbsp vegetable oil

  • Optional: mushrooms, snow peas, baby corn, bok choy

  • Toppings: sesame oil, sesame seeds, cilantro, chili flakes, lime wedges


Instructions

  • Slice beef and marinate with hoisin, soy sauce, garlic, and ginger for 15 minutes.

  • Boil noodles according to package; rinse under cold water.

  • Stir-fry vegetables in oil for 3–4 minutes. Remove.

  • Sear beef on high heat until browned.

  • Return noodles and veggies to the pan, toss with remaining sauce.

  • Drizzle sesame oil, top with sesame seeds, cilantro, and chili. Serve hot.

Notes

  • Use tamari and rice noodles for gluten-free version.
  • Add Sriracha or chili oil for heat.
  • Marinate beef longer for deeper flavor.
  • Use a wok or wide skillet for best stir-fry results.
